Open bg

Image, Resize, 75% SS

C&P

Crop to the canvas size 600 x 600

then apply Chelle's mask WSL_Mask117

Layers, Merge, Merge Group


Open ribbonframe

Image, Resize, 80%

C&P

Place centrally if not already there


Open the bg again

Resize 60%

C&P

Place under the ribbonframe layer

and do a Selection Delete with an expand of 5


Open bench

Image, Resize 60%

C&P

Place as mine


Move under the ribbonframe

and apply a shadow of

0, 7, 17, 30.00, Black

and

Select and expand again using magic wand on the ribbonframe

then

Hit Delete on the bench layer

Selections None


Now add your tube - resized as you like

I resized 90% and made it look like she's sitting on the bench :D

Apply same drop as before to it
